1(a)Monocot root and Dicot rootShow solution
## Anatomical differences between monocot root and dicot root

| Feature | Dicot root | Monocot root |
|---|---|---|
| Xylem bundles | Usually 2 to 4 (few) | Usually more than 6 i.e. polyarch |
| Pith | Small or inconspicuous | Large and well developed |
| Secondary growth | Present in many dicot roots | Absent |
| Conjunctive tissue | Present between xylem and phloem | Present, but root remains primary and does not show secondary growth |

### Main identifying points
- In a dicot root, xylem and phloem are fewer in number, and the pith is small.
- In a monocot root, xylem bundles are many and the pith is large.
- Secondary growth occurs in dicot roots but not in monocot roots.

### Simple labelled sketch points
- Outer epiblema with root hairs
- Cortex
- Endodermis with Casparian strips
- Pericycle
- Xylem and phloem
- Pith (small in dicot, large in monocot)

1(b)Monocot stem and Dicot stemShow solution
## Anatomical differences between monocot stem and dicot stem

| Feature | Dicot stem | Monocot stem |
|---|---|---|
| Hypodermis | Collenchymatous | Sclerenchymatous |
| Vascular bundles | Arranged in a ring | Scattered in the ground tissue |
| Cambium | Present in vascular bundles | Absent |
| Type of vascular bundles | Conjoint, open | Conjoint, closed |
| Phloem parenchyma | Usually present | Absent |
| Bundle sheath | Not a prominent feature | Each bundle surrounded by a sclerenchymatous bundle sheath |
| Pith | Large and distinct | Ground tissue large and conspicuous; distinct pith not well separated |
| Secondary growth | Usually present | Usually absent |

### Main identifying points
- A dicot stem has vascular bundles in a ring and each bundle is open because cambium is present.
- A monocot stem has scattered vascular bundles, each with a sclerenchymatous bundle sheath, and bundles are closed.

### Simple labelled sketch points
- Dicot stem: epidermis, collenchymatous hypodermis, cortex, endodermis, pericycle, ring of vascular bundles, pith
- Monocot stem: epidermis, sclerenchymatous hypodermis, scattered vascular bundles with bundle sheath, large ground tissue

3The transverse section of a plant material shows the following anatomical features - (a) the vascular bundles are conjoint, scattered and surrounded by a sclerenchymatous bundle sheaths. (b) phloem parenchyma is absent. What will you identify it as?Show solution
The given features are:
- conjoint, scattered vascular bundles
- surrounded by sclerenchymatous bundle sheaths
- phloem parenchyma absent

These are the characteristic features of a monocotyledonous stem.
